Few plants in the Indian tradition carry the double weight that the bilva does. To the physician it is a dependable astringent for disorders of the gut and one of the pillars of the daśamūla group; to the worshipper of Śiva it is the leaf without which the deity is said to accept nothing. This essay reads the two traditions together and sets them beside what the laboratory has since found. It identifies the tree botanically, examines the classical Ayurvedic account of its fruit, considers its nutritional and phytochemical composition, reviews the modern pharmacological evidence, and notes the cautions that responsible use requires. It then returns to the devotional life of the plant, its bond with the month of Śrāvaṇa, and the rites of its offering. Sanskrit verses are given in the original with IAST transliteration and an English rendering so that the reader may weigh the sources directly.

Introduction

There is an old habit in Indian thought of refusing to keep the body and the spirit in separate rooms. The same herb that a vaidya grinds for a stubborn case of dysentery may be the same leaf a pilgrim carries, washed and folded, to lay on a liṅga. The bilva tree is perhaps the clearest example of this refusal. It is at once a medicine of long standing, a fruit of real nutritional worth, and a form of the divine. What follows tries to hold all three together, giving the classical texts their voice, the modern studies their say, and the ritual its due.

Botanical profile

Bilva is Aegle marmelos (L.) Corrêa, a medium-sized deciduous tree belonging to the citrus family Rutaceae. It is slow-growing and hardy, enduring dry, difficult soils where softer trees fail. Its branches carry sharp spines. The leaves are alternate and aromatic, usually trifoliate though sometimes bearing up to five leaflets, each leaflet ovate, pointed, and shallowly toothed. The flowers are small, greenish white, and sweetly scented, gathered in loose clusters on the young wood. The fruit is round to oval with a hard woody rind, grey green while unripe and turning yellowish as it matures, and it gives off a characteristic pleasant smell. Within lies an orange, sweet, resinous pulp studded with many seeds set in mucilage. The tree is native to India and is found across South and Southeast Asia, from the sub-Himalayan tract through the plains into the drier forests of the peninsula.

Bilva in Ayurveda

The standing of bilva in medicine rests first on its root, which opens the bṛhat pañcamūla, the five greater roots of the daśamūla, standing before agnimantha, śyonāka, gambhārī, and pāṭalā. A decoction of the ten roots is still among the most prescribed of formulations for its work against vāta, swelling, and fever.

On the fruit, the classical texts insist on one distinction above all, that between the ripe and the unripe. Vāgbhaṭa puts it plainly in the Aṣṭāṅgahṛdaya, in the chapter on the nature of foods:

पक्वं सुदुर्जरं बिल्वं दोषलं पूतिमारुतम्। दीपनं कफवातघ्नं बालं ग्राह्युभयं च तत्॥

IAST: pakvaṁ sudurjaraṁ bilvaṁ doṣalaṁ pūtimārutam, dīpanaṁ kaphavātaghnaṁ bālaṁ grāhy ubhayaṁ ca tat.

The ripe bilva, he says, is heavy and hard to digest, it disturbs the doṣas, and it leaves a foul wind behind it. The tender, unripe fruit does the opposite: it kindles the digestive fire and settles kapha and vāta, and both states of the fruit share the grāhi quality, the power to bind and absorb. A student who remembers only one line about bilva should remember this one, for it corrects the common error of eating the sweet ripe pulp for a complaint that in truth calls for the unripe fruit.

In the language of dravyaguṇa, the unripe fruit is astringent and bitter in taste, light and dry in quality, hot in potency, and pungent after digestion, and it pacifies kapha and vāta. Both Caraka and Suśruta count it among the finest of the saṅgrāhi substances, those that check flux by drawing off excess fluid and firming the stool. Cakradatta later recommended it in chronic dysentery, loose motions, and piles, while Bhāvaprakāśa and Baṅgasena treated it as a leading remedy for the diseases of the intestines.

Traditional uses

Almost every part of the tree has been put to use, which is why the tradition calls it a complete tree of medicine. The unripe fruit, dried into the pulp known as belagiri, is the classic remedy for atisāra, pravāhikā, and grahaṇī, that is, diarrhoea, dysentery, and the group of chronic bowel disorders. The ripe pulp, taken as a cooling drink or sharbat, is valued in the hot months as a mild laxative and a soother of thirst and of a burning stomach. The leaf, pressed for its fresh juice, has a long reputation in the management of prameha or diabetes, and also appears in remedies for fever and for eye complaints. The root belongs to the daśamūla and carries its vāta-quieting action, while the bark and the aromatic rind have been used for digestive and febrile conditions. Beyond Ayurveda, the same applications recur in Unani and in village practice across the subcontinent, most consistently for the stomach and the bowel.

Nutrition

The ripe pulp is a genuinely nourishing food, not merely a medicine. Reported figures vary with cultivar, ripeness, and the method of analysis, but the broad picture from Indian food-composition data and published studies is steady. Roughly sixty percent of the fresh pulp is water. Carbohydrate is the dominant nutrient, in the region of thirty grams per hundred grams, which places the energy value near the higher end for a fresh fruit, commonly cited between about ninety and one hundred and forty kilocalories per hundred grams depending on the source. Protein sits near two grams and fat below half a gram. There is useful dietary fibre, close to three grams, much of it in the form of pectin and mucilage, the soluble, gel-forming fibres that account for the fruit's soothing, bulk-giving effect on the gut.

Among the micronutrients, bael is best known for riboflavin, vitamin B2, which it carries in a quantity unusual among fruits, alongside thiamine and niacin. It supplies vitamin C, with reported values ranging widely from single figures up to around sixty milligrams per hundred grams in fresh pulp, and it contributes beta-carotene as a precursor of vitamin A. The fruit also provides useful amounts of potassium, calcium, and phosphorus, along with smaller amounts of iron and copper. Taken together, this makes the ripe fruit a worthwhile source of energy, soluble fibre, and antioxidants during the season when it is eaten.

Modern scientific evidence

Contemporary research has taken an active interest in bilva, and much of what it reports lines up with the classical picture rather than against it. The plant is chemically rich. Its most studied phytochemicals include coumarins such as marmelosin, imperatorin, marmin, umbelliferone, and psoralen, together with the alkaloid aegeline, tannins, flavonoids, terpenoids, and essential oils. The tannins are worth singling out, since their astringency is the plausible chemical basis for the very grāhi action the texts describe.

The most direct validation of tradition concerns the gut. Experimental studies of the unripe fruit have demonstrated antidiarrhoeal activity and have identified possible effects on microbial adherence, invasion, and enterotoxin action. These findings lend scientific support to its traditional use, although they do not yet constitute definitive clinical proof. Alongside this, extracts of the fruit and leaf show gastroprotective and anti-ulcer activity in experimental models, with the coumarin marmin implicated in protecting the stomach lining.

A second large body of work addresses blood sugar. Leaf extracts inhibit the digestive enzymes alpha-amylase and alpha-glucosidase, which would slow the release of glucose from a meal, and they lower blood glucose in diabetic animals; a smaller number of clinical reports point the same way. To these are added consistent findings of antioxidant and anti-inflammatory activity, and, in preclinical settings, antimicrobial, antifungal, antiviral, hepatoprotective, cardioprotective, radioprotective, and anticancer effects.

Two honest qualifications belong here. Most of this evidence comes from laboratory assays and animal experiments; well-designed human trials remain few, and the doses, extracts, and plant parts differ from study to study. So while the direction of the findings is encouraging and often agrees with centuries of use, it is not yet the same thing as clinical proof for any specific treatment. Taken together, these investigations provide a plausible biochemical explanation for many of the therapeutic actions described in the classical Ayurvedic literature, while also highlighting the need for larger clinical trials.

Safety

As a food, ripe bael is well tolerated and has a long record of ordinary use. A few sensible cautions still apply. Because the fruit is astringent and firming, taking it in large amounts, especially the unripe fruit or its preparations, can bind the bowel and produce constipation or a sense of heaviness, which is exactly the disturbance Vāgbhaṭa attributed to the ripe fruit eaten to excess. People who are prone to constipation or who have weak digestion and a vāta tendency should be moderate.

Since experimental studies suggest that bilva leaf preparations may lower blood glucose, people taking antidiabetic medication should use medicinal preparations only under professional supervision. Reliable evidence concerning medicinal doses during pregnancy and breastfeeding remains insufficient. These cautions do not detract from the ripe fruit as an ordinary food; they simply distinguish dietary consumption from therapeutic dosing.

The bond with Śrāvaṇa

The tie between bilva and the monsoon month of Śrāvaṇa is usually explained through the churning of the ocean. The old accounts place that churning in Śrāvaṇa and remember that the first thing to rise from the sea was not nectar but the poison hālāhala, whose heat threatened to burn the three worlds. Śiva gathered it and held it in his throat, which darkened, and from that he took the name Nīlakaṇṭha, the blue-throated one. Tradition holds that offerings such as water, milk, and bilva leaves symbolically soothe the heat borne by Śiva after he consumed the hālāhala.

A reader of the Ayurvedic texts will notice a quieter reason as well. Śrāvaṇa falls in the rains, the season when the digestive fire is at its lowest, when vāta is easily provoked, and when the very bowel disorders discussed above arrive in force. The remedy the season asks for is precisely a substance that warms digestion, binds the bowel, and calms vāta and kapha, which is to say bilva. The bilva offered to Śiva in Śrāvaṇa belongs to the same tree whose unripe fruit Ayurveda particularly values during the rains for its grāhi, dīpana, and vāta-kapha hara actions. The ritual and medical traditions thus converge upon the same plant, though they employ different parts of it for different purposes.

Bilva in the Purāṇas and Śaiva worship

In the Purāṇic imagination the tree is not merely dear to Śiva but a form of him, and the Śiva Purāṇa holds that when nothing else is at hand, a single bilva leaf completes the worship. The threefold leaf invites reading, and the Bilvāṣṭaka attributed to Ādi Śaṅkarācārya offers the best known:

त्रिदलं त्रिगुणाकारं त्रिनेत्रं च त्रयायुधम्। त्रिजन्मपापसंहारम् एकबिल्वं शिवार्पणम्॥

IAST: tridalaṁ triguṇākāraṁ trinetraṁ ca trayāyudham, trijanma-pāpa-saṁhāram eka-bilvaṁ śivārpaṇam.

Three-leaved, shaped after the three guṇas, an emblem of the three eyes and the three weapons of Śiva, and a destroyer of the sins of three births, this one bilva leaf is offered to Śiva. The same hymn reads the single leaf as the whole trinity, Brahmā at the stalk, Viṣṇu in the middle, Śiva at the tip:

मूलतो ब्रह्मरूपाय मध्यतो विष्णुरूपिणे। अग्रतः शिवरूपाय एकबिल्वं शिवार्पणम्॥

IAST: mūlato brahma-rūpāya madhyato viṣṇu-rūpiṇe, agrataḥ śiva-rūpāya eka-bilvaṁ śivārpaṇam.

Two familiar narratives account for the leaf's power, and they can be told briefly. The first, attached to the night of Śivarātri, concerns a hunter who took shelter in a bilva tree above a forgotten liṅga. Having eaten nothing since dawn he had fasted without meaning to; staying awake he kept the vigil; and as the branches stirred, dewy leaves dropped onto the stone below, so that even the offering was made in ignorance. Moved through the night to spare the lives of deer that pleaded with him, the hardened man was softened, and for all of this, done unknowingly yet truly, Śiva granted him at the end the highest state. The lesson is that a single leaf laid down with a clean heart outweighs a lifetime of wrong.

The second kind of narrative concerns the tree's origin, and every version binds it to the goddess of fortune. In the telling of the Bṛhaddharma Purāṇa, the bilva grew from a part of Lakṣmī herself, offered to Śiva in the extremity of her devotion; the Agni Purāṇa traces it instead to the cow of the sage Bhṛgu and says that from the tree arose Śrī, which is why the fruit is called śrīphala. The connection is marked in a verse of offering:

लक्ष्म्याः स्तनत उत्पन्नं महादेवस्य च प्रियम्। बिल्ववृक्षं प्रयच्छामि एकबिल्वं शिवार्पणम्॥

IAST: lakṣmyāḥ stanata utpannaṁ mahādevasya ca priyam, bilva-vṛkṣaṁ prayacchāmi eka-bilvaṁ śivārpaṇam.

Sprung from Lakṣmī and dear to Mahādeva, this bilva tree I present, and a single leaf of it I offer to Śiva. Older than either Purāṇa, the Śrī Sūkta already speaks of a bilva born of the goddess's austerity:

आदित्यवर्णे तपसोऽधिजातो वनस्पतिस्तव वृक्षोऽथ बिल्वः। तस्य फलानि तपसा नुदन्तु या अन्तरा याश्च बाह्या अलक्ष्मीः॥

IAST: āditya-varṇe tapaso'dhijāto vanaspatis tava vṛkṣo'tha bilvaḥ, tasya phalāni tapasā nudantu yā antarā yāś ca bāhyā alakṣmīḥ.

O goddess bright as the sun, from your austerity arose this best of trees, the bilva; may its fruits drive off every misfortune, the poverty within us and the poverty that presses from without. Read together, these verses explain why one tree can be dear at once to Lakṣmī and to Śiva.

The manner of offering

The devotional literature is exact about how the leaf is given, and the exactness is part of the devotion. The verse of offering may be the tridalaṁ triguṇākāram, or the words the Liṅga Purāṇa places in Śiva's own mouth:

मणिमुक्ताप्रवालैस्तु रत्नैरप्यर्चनं कृतम्। न गृह्णामि बिना देवि बिल्वपत्रैर्वरानने॥

IAST: maṇi-muktā-pravālais tu ratnair apy arcanaṁ kṛtam, na gṛhṇāmi binā devi bilva-patrair varānane.

Worship made with gems and pearls and coral and every jewel, he tells the goddess, I do not accept, O fair one, if it comes without bilva leaves. Those who cannot manage a verse may offer the leaf with the five syllables oṁ namaḥ śivāya, or with the name of Śiva simply spoken, for the purity of the feeling is what is asked.

The leaf itself should be whole and soft and unbroken, of three lobes, and free of holes. Two blemishes are avoided, the cakra, a whitish patch on the surface, and the vajra, the knot on the stalk. The leaf is washed clean and laid face downward, its smooth upper surface toward the liṅga. Number carries weight, and on the great days, on Śivarātri, on the Mondays of Śrāvaṇa, on Pradoṣa, a worshipper may offer eleven, twenty-one, thirty-one, one hundred and eight, or a thousand and eight leaves; yet the literature that counts so carefully insists that one leaf given in devotion is enough. The plucking has its own courtesy, made with a spoken request recorded in the Ācārendu:

अमृतोद्भव श्रीवृक्ष महादेवप्रियः सदा। गृह्णामि तव पत्राणि शिवपूजार्थमादरात्॥

IAST: amṛtodbhava śrī-vṛkṣa mahādeva-priyaḥ sadā, gṛhṇāmi tava patrāṇi śiva-pūjārtham ādarāt.

O auspicious tree born of nectar, ever dear to Mahādeva, with reverence I take your leaves for the worship of Śiva. There are days on which the leaf is not plucked, the fourth, eighth, ninth, and fourteenth of the fortnight, the new moon, the moment of saṅkrānti, and Monday; on these one offers a leaf taken the day before. The tradition adds a gentle relief, holding that bilva leaves never go stale or become impure, so that a leaf already offered may be washed and offered again.

Bilva at a glance

AttributeDetail
Botanical nameAegle marmelos (L.) Corrêa, family Rutaceae
Sanskrit namesBilva, śrīphala, śāṇḍilya, śailūṣa, mālūra, sadāphala, śivadruma
Parts usedUnripe fruit and dried pulp (belagiri), leaf, root, bark, ripe pulp
Rasa, guṇa, vīrya, vipākaAstringent and bitter; light and dry; hot potency; pungent after digestion
Doṣa actionPacifies kapha and vāta
Cardinal actionGrāhi or saṅgrāhi, that is, absorbent and bowel-binding
Classical usesDiarrhoea, dysentery, chronic bowel disorders, and as part of daśamūla
Key phytochemicalsCoumarins including marmelosin, imperatorin, marmin, umbelliferone, and psoralen; aegeline, tannins, and flavonoids
Notable nutrientsCarbohydrate, soluble fibre (pectin and mucilage), riboflavin, vitamin C, potassium
Modern evidenceAntidiarrhoeal and gastroprotective, antidiabetic, antioxidant and anti-inflammatory, mostly preclinical
Main cautionExcess can constipate; may lower blood sugar; limited safety data in pregnancy
Ritual roleForemost offering to Śiva; three lobes read as guṇas, eyes, and trinity
Auspicious timeŚrāvaṇa, its Mondays, and Śivarātri

Closing

To hold the accounts of bilva side by side is to see something about the mind that produced them. The physician values the unripe fruit for binding a loose gut and the root for quieting the wind in the body; the food scientist finds soluble fibre, riboflavin, and potassium in the ripe pulp; the pharmacologist isolates coumarins and tannins and watches them settle the bowel and lower blood sugar; and the Purāṇas value the leaf as a form of the three gods, born of Lakṣmī, dearer to Śiva than any jewel. These are not rival claims about the tree but four readings of one plant. It is fitting that the season which most needs the medicine of bilva is also the season that most heaps its leaves upon Śiva, as though the rains, the healing, and the worship were all keeping a single time.
